Larry King has "broken heart" after death of son and daughter

Larry King issues an emotional statement following the deaths of his son Andy and daughter Chaia in the last month.

Veteran news broadcaster Larry King has issued an emotional statement following the deaths of two of his children over the last month.

The 86-year-old lost his son Andy, 65, to a heart attack at the end of July and last week his 52-year-old daughter Chaia passed away following a battle with lung cancer.

In a message posted on his Facebook page, King wrote: "It is with sadness and a father's broken heart that I confirm the recent loss of two of my children, Andy King, and Chaia King. Both of them were good and kind souls and they will be greatly missed.

"Andy passed away unexpectedly of a heart attack on July 28th, and Chaia passed on August 20th, only a short time after having been diagnosed with lung cancer.

"Losing them feels so out of order. No parent should have to bury a child.

"My family and I thank you for your outpouring of kind sentiments and well wishes. In this moment, we need a little time and privacy to heal. I thank you for respecting that."

King, who has three other children, is said to be unable to attend the funerals of Andy and Chaia as he continues his recovery from a serious stroke last year.
